Output d3904a58ef16becea6aa06ab0d7a1b7b7c960110f6ffe871bf9c38e761cd27b2:0

value
368430265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29349c45fe2e67c2852a1184d777ea62823931c1 OP_EQUAL
address
35Ster3mBn4M2ErXgECJ2WAUdf7KjgUhKR
transaction
d3904a58ef16becea6aa06ab0d7a1b7b7c960110f6ffe871bf9c38e761cd27b2
spent
true